How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Federal Way?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Federal Way Studio Apartments | $1,333 | $753 | $2,310 |
| Federal Way 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,751 | $893 | $3,790 |
| Federal Way 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,133 | $1,225 | $4,965 |
| Federal Way 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,536 | $1,800 | $5,100 |
| Federal Way 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,245 | $2,096 | $2,452 |
